What is the cheapest month to fly from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port is February, where tickets cost $1,082 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are January and August,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,680 and $1,586 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 24%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 17 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Ho Chi Minh City to Washington Dulles Airport?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Washington Dulles Airport with an airline and back to Ho Chi Minh City with another airline. Booking your flights between Ho Chi Minh City and IAD can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
